A deputy in Colleton County, South Carolina was shot to death early this morning after responding to a silent alarm at a home. The homeowner was not home at the time of the apparent break-in, but the homeowner’s son, who was also notified by the alarm company, arrived on the scene and found the wounded officer, Deputy Dennis Compton, who died shortly after 3:00am.

It goes without saying that this killing, and the continuing search for the deputy’s killer or killers, has been the big story of the day here in the Lowcountry.

At one point, I was in the feed room at my Channel 37, listening to a press conference conducted by Colleton Sheriff George Malone. At one point, a reporter asked Malone how old Compton was. The sheriff looked down at his notes and said Compton’s birthdate was 11-23-68.

I felt chills.

He was just one year older than me. One year to the day.

We never know just how much time we have, do we?
